called to another world?

Where is this?

A very reasonable question crossed Budi's mind. Of course, all of a sudden you move from the street to a strange room with a lot of people dressed in weird costumes too, surely the first question you will ask is where you are now.

Budi opens his mouth but then closes again after hearing their conversation. Damn it The language they use is like a mixture of Japanese, English, Arabic, and Greek, the point is very clear that Budi doesn't understand and they also certainly don't understand Budi's language.

Then one of them walked toward Budi with a polite smile. She is a girl around the age of 17 with cute pink lips and blonde hair.

One word that can describe the girl is 'amazing'.

The girl said something to Budi that obviously Budi didn't understand, so he just nodded like a chicken. It is impossible, even Budi's English score is very low, let alone an alien language like that.

Then he smiled politely and stretched his hand in front of Budi. Like an automatic response, Budi immediately took a helping hand from the girl.

"Woah, so gentle, I just found out this happy just by holding a woman's hand."

Budi's mind continued to spin in confusion. Even he had forgotten his worries about where he was at the moment. Happiness from holding a beautiful girl's hand makes Budi's brain, which is not too smart, become stupid right away.

Then the girl guides Budi through a luxurious hallway, in the alley there are many flowers and stout figures using swords or spears. But Budi didn't have the chance to admire the beauty of the art because the girl in front of him seemed to suck up all of Budi's attention.

After walking down the hallway, what awaited Budi and the girl was a large, very luxurious door with two soldiers guarding on both sides. They carried a spear and shield while standing proudly. Seeing the arrival of the girl and Budi, the two soldiers immediately bowed their heads deeply. As if the lower they looked down, the more polite they were.

The girl smiled kindly as she nodded, then she said something that Budi didn't understand again. Hearing the girl's words, Budi just nodded like a chicken again.

After receiving a response from Budi, the girl releases her hand from Budi and walks forward, swiftly following Budi's footsteps. After opening the luxurious door, what appeared in front of Budi was a throne made of gold with an old man with a crown on his head and a beautiful woman sitting next to him.

The girl walked forward then bent her knees, while Budi who followed behind the girl looked at this scene foolishly.

Budi felt familiar with this situation, but he did not know where he had seen it. So he dug up his memories that couldn't even memorize chemical formulas.

Suddenly a flash of enlightenment came, Budi finally remembered where he had seen this situation, the answer was in the novel.

The main character is suddenly sent to another world to defeat the demon lord or something, a very simple and predictable template, but still often used.

Which means that he became a hero to fight the demon king? Don't joke, Budi is always the last in sports values, he's also a coward who doesn't even dare to see chicken cutting. How can such a person become a hero?

The most important thing is instead of going to another world and saving the world is the job of Japanese, Chinese, or Koreans?
